Differential D12224 Diff 29377 src/applications/legalpad/controller/LegalpadDocumentSignatureAddController.php
Changeset View
Changeset View
Standalone View
Standalone View
src/applications/legalpad/controller/LegalpadDocumentSignatureAddController.php
Show First 20 Lines • Show All 111 Lines • ▼ Show 20 Lines | if ($request->isFormPost()) { | ||||
return id(new AphrontRedirectResponse())->setURI($next_uri); | return id(new AphrontRedirectResponse())->setURI($next_uri); | ||||
} | } | ||||
} | } | ||||
$form = id(new AphrontFormView()) | $form = id(new AphrontFormView()) | ||||
->setUser($viewer); | ->setUser($viewer); | ||||
if ($is_individual) { | if ($is_individual) { | ||||
$user_handles = $this->loadViewerHandles($v_users); | |||||
$form | $form | ||||
->appendChild( | ->appendControl( | ||||
id(new AphrontFormTokenizerControl()) | id(new AphrontFormTokenizerControl()) | ||||
->setLabel(pht('Exempt User')) | ->setLabel(pht('Exempt User')) | ||||
->setName('users') | ->setName('users') | ||||
->setLimit(1) | ->setLimit(1) | ||||
->setDatasource(new PhabricatorPeopleDatasource()) | ->setDatasource(new PhabricatorPeopleDatasource()) | ||||
->setValue($user_handles) | ->setValue($v_users) | ||||
->setError($e_user)); | ->setError($e_user)); | ||||
} else { | } else { | ||||
$form | $form | ||||
->appendChild( | ->appendChild( | ||||
id(new AphrontFormTextControl()) | id(new AphrontFormTextControl()) | ||||
->setLabel(pht('Company Name')) | ->setLabel(pht('Company Name')) | ||||
->setName('name') | ->setName('name') | ||||
->setError($e_name) | ->setError($e_name) | ||||
Show All 26 Lines |